Photovoltaic system repair services involve diagnosing and fixing issues that may affect the performance of solar power systems. Technicians assess components such as solar panels, inverters, wiring, and mounting hardware to identify faults or damage. Repairs can include replacing malfunctioning panels, repairing wiring connections, or restoring inverter functions to ensure the system operates efficiently. These services help maintain the energy output of the solar setup and prevent minor problems from escalating into more costly repairs or system failures.

Addressing common problems like shading, dirt buildup, or physical damage, photovoltaic repair services help optimize system performance and extend the lifespan of solar equipment. Over time, exposure to weather elements can cause wear and tear, leading to reduced energy production or complete system outages. Repair services aim to restore functionality by fixing or replacing damaged parts, ensuring that the system continues to generate power reliably. Regular inspections and prompt repairs can also prevent safety hazards associated with electrical faults or compromised mounting structures.

The overview below groups typical Photovoltaic System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Parkton, MD.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Replacement Costs - Replacing damaged or outdated photovoltaic system components typically costs between $1,000 and $3,000, depending on the size and type of parts needed. For example, a damaged inverter may fall within this range, with larger system replacements costing more.

Repair Expenses - Repair services for photovoltaic systems usually range from $200 to $1,000, covering issues like wiring faults or inverter repairs. Minor repairs tend to be on the lower end, while more complex fixes can approach the higher end of the spectrum.

Labor Charges - Labor fees for photovoltaic system repairs generally fall between $50 and $150 per hour, with total costs varying based on the scope of work. A standard repair project might take a few hours, influencing the overall cost estimate.

Additional Costs - Additional expenses may include permits, inspection fees, or system diagnostics, which can add $100 to $500 to the total repair cost. These costs vary based on local regulations and specific service requirements.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common issues that require photovoltaic system repair? Common problems include inverter failures, shading issues, wiring faults, and damaged panels that can affect system performance.

How can I tell if my photovoltaic system needs repairs? Signs such as decreased energy production, error messages from the inverter, or visible damage to panels may indicate the need for professional repair services.

What types of repair services are available for photovoltaic systems? Repair services typically include inverter replacement, wiring repairs, panel cleaning or replacement, and troubleshooting electrical faults.

How long do photovoltaic system repairs usually take? Repair durations vary depending on the issue but are generally completed within a few hours to a couple of days by local service providers.
